Default Can you force a watch/shift change?

OK, so I found a convoy and put a torpedo into a large old split freighter. Its bow is awash and the ship is barely creeping along, falling further and further behind the main body. An escort has fallen back a bit to keep an eye on the freighter. I'm following the freighter, waiting for the ship to either sink or for the escort to give up and leave the freighter behind, where I'll then surface and finish the poor thing off with my deck gun.

I'm cruising along at 1/3 when my speed drops to zero. I try reissuing the "ahead 1/3" command and am told "cannot comply". I try another command, this time the silent running command, and am again told "cannot comply". Having seen this kind of thing happen in SH3, I look at the crew management screen, where I then notice this:




The current watch is asleep???? What??

(I typically don't go to battle stations unless I need a lot of torpedoes in short succession or I expect an attack and may need everyone on duty for damage control.)

I tried going to battle stations (where at least that lower line ended up having awake crew members and status bars to the sides) but when I secured the crew from battle stations/general quarters, the third watch still showed the same thing.

Have any of you ran into this and/or do you know if it's possible to force a change in the watch?

From the screen above, it looked like the second watch should be the active one and the first and third should be asleep. (The second may have been the active one, but when it went from second to third shift, those crew members apparently decided to sleep in a bit.)

How the h*ll do you get people to the "Damage control team"?
Do "buy" them when docked in port or what, ´cause I can´t drag them there while at sea.......I think.
Yeah, I spent renown to acquire those crew members while docked before a patrol and assigned them to the DC team. It's on the crew screen where you give the promotions and medals. It's the other option with the names on the left and you drag and drop from there to the DC team over on the right. Just keep an eye on the renown (listed for each potential crew member) because you're not asked "are you sure" before the assignment is made and your renown is gone.

While you can move men between watches I've found there's no point. The watches are already set to change automatically when required so under normal circumstances the only moves I may need to make are to put men into damage control while I need them there and then move them back to their original watch positions once the need for D.C. is over. The crew for the most part can be left to look after themselves, that is after all the whole point of the watch system in the first place.
